Output 60e8bc32fe0c29629a5244e7e6cbba817b1d2696ce105877160d1f5b0beec47a:0

value
13403622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ef6b2854862b1a7b1c2149b4320a19967e5d5472 OP_EQUAL
address
3PWwnpxLj35cNwWWP1WYcr1RDmt6f6H5ZC
transaction
60e8bc32fe0c29629a5244e7e6cbba817b1d2696ce105877160d1f5b0beec47a
spent
true